Reviewed yesterday NEW The Sanouva is situated in District 1 so is really well situated for sight seeing in Saigon with attractions such as War Remnants Museum, Reunification Palace, Ben Tranh Market and Notre Dame Cathedral etc. being a short walk away. It is on a busy street but we weren't disturbed by the noise. There is a funeral place a few days away which can be a little bit noisy.
Our room was on the 9th floor. It was fairly small but well equipped and comfortable. The bathroom was also well equipped. Free Wi-Fi was available throughout the hotel.
Breakfast was served on the ground floor and was buffet style. There was a good range of options available to suit western and Asian tastes. Made to order omelettes were also available and these were really good. The hotel also has a restaurant which has a good variety of food available. We had a meal there whilst we were waiting to go to the airport which was good.
All the hotel staff were very friendly and helpful. Information was available about tours that could be arranged via the hotel.
Room Tip: Request a room at the back of the hotel if you're a light sleeper
